Mexican Black Kingsnake

Mexican Black Kingsnakes (MBK) are nocturnal snakes native to southern Arizona and northwestern Mexico. MBK’s are most well known for their black/dark brown coloration and iridescent reflection in sunlight. MBK’s tend to have little to no patterns,

Adult MBK’s grow between 40-52 inches.

When preparing your enclosure, keep in mind that MBK’s native habitat tend to be arid with sandy to stony soil. MBK’s can climb, but make sure to include multiple hides. The minimum enclosure size for one MBK is 48'“ L x 24” W x 24” H.
